(Dearborn County, Ind.) - The Dearborn County Sheriff's Office is advising local residents to be aware of a nationwide scam.
If you receive a text saying that you have unpaid tolls, do not click on the link.
Instead, report the message as spam and delete it from your phone.
According to the Dearborn County Sheriff's Office, the Toll Office will only mail you a copy of your toll with a picture of the vehicle and license plate info.
